Mahabharata Karna Parva – परस्परं चाप्य अपरे पट्टिशैर असिभिस तथा

Shloka (श्लोक)

परस्परं चाप्य अपरे पट्टिशैर असिभिस तथा
शक्तिभिर भिण्डिपालैश च नखरप्रासतॊमरैः

⚡ Quick Meaning

The warriors fought among themselves using swords and axes, employing various weapons in their fierce confrontation.

Translations

English Translation

The violence escalated as warriors engaged one another with swords and axes, showcasing the myriad of weapons they wielded. Their fierce determination was evident as they used all their strength in the battle, emphasizing the chaotic and brutal nature of warfare.
